然后在管理electron生命周期的项目名.js 文件中,完成以下代码以唤起和关闭后端exe 点击查看代码 'use strict'import{ app, protocol,BrowserWindow}from'electron'import{ createProtocol }from'vue-cli-plugin-electron-builder/lib'importinstallExtension, {VUEJS3_DEVTOOLS }from'electron-devtools-installer'varcmd=req...
process.env.IS_ELECTRON 三、开发总结 1. 配置项目图标 参考文档:https://nklayman.github.io/vue-cli-plugin-electron-builder/guide/recipes.html#icons 使用electron-icon-builder, 生成符合Electron的图标 ① 安装 代码语言:javascript 代码运行次数:0 运行 AI代码解释 npm install--save-dev electron-icon-bui...
#系列文章 vue3+electron开发桌面软件入门与实战(0)——创建electron应用中二少年学编程:vue3+electron开发桌面软件入门与实战(1)——创建electron+vue3主体项目 中二少年学编程:vue3+electron开发桌面软件…
创建一个新的 Vue3 项目: vuecreatemy-electron-app 进入项目目录: cdmy-electron-app 设置为国内镜像 setELECTRON_MIRROR="https://npmmirror.com/mirrors/electron/" 安装Electron 和 electron-builder: npminstall--save-dev electron electron-builder 创建一个main.js文件和一个electron-builder.yml文件,并将其...
三、electron中运行vue项目 electron增加窗口显示 一个桌面端软件,最起码也得有个窗口吧。 ==把electron的main.js改造一下,上代码:== const{app,BrowserWindow}=require('electron')constcreateWindow=()=>{constwin=newBrowserWindow({width:800,height:600})win.loadURL('http://127.0.0.1:5173/')// win.loa...
下面会使用electron-builder 来构建程序。 2. 安装脚手架 # 安装 vue-cli 和 脚手架样板代码 npm install -g vue-cli vue create my-electron # 安装依赖并运行你的程序 cd my-electron vue add electron-builder 1. 2. 3. 4. 5. 6. 3. 运行 ...
Electron Vue快速指南 Electorn官网提供了一种标准步骤,文档的描述比较中性,没有在Vue或者React做出任何倾向,选择哪种前端技术取决于你,这里分享一种标准步骤:第一步: 创建Vue App 第二步: 添加electron-builder 第三步: 安装router,用于页面切换 第四步: 现在可以运行Electron App了!最后一步:项目代码...
简化桌面端开发 (1)Electron 基于 Chromium 和 Node.js,可以使用 HTML, CSS 和 JavaScript 构建应用 (2)提供Electron api 和 NodeJS api 社区活跃 2. 兼容性 xp无缘了, 可能需要使用nwjs等方案 二、项目搭建 1. 使用 vue cli 创建vue项目 vue create electron-test复制代码 ...
app.on('activate',() =>{if(win ==null){createWindow(); } });const{ ipcMain } =require('electron') ipcMain.on("ping",function(even,arg){console.log(arg) even.returnValue="pong"}) AI代码助手复制代码 3.将package.json文件和main.js文件放入到 vue打包完成的dist目录下 ...
dist - 由脚本 script/create-dist.py 创建的临时发布目录 external_binaries - 下载的不支持通过 gyp 构建的预编译第三方框架 应用工程目录 使用electron-vue模版创建的Electron工程结构如下图。 和前端工程的项目结构类似,Electron项目的目录结构如下所示: ...